Piqueros, Ecuador is a surf spot on the mainland Pacific coast known for its powerful, less-crowded waves and a more local, off-the-beaten-path feel.
Quick description
- Wave type: Mainly beach break, with shifting sandbanks
- Best for: Intermediate to advanced surfers
- Wave quality: Can offer fast, punchy waves with hollow sections when conditions line up
- Crowd level: Usually lighter than Ecuador’s better-known surf destinations
- Vibe: Remote, laid-back, and more exposed to raw Pacific swell
Conditions
Piqueros tends to work best with: - Consistent Pacific swell - Good sand formation - Light to offshore winds
Because it’s an exposed beach break, conditions can change quickly, and the surf may be powerful or rough when swell is too large or winds are poor.
What to expect
- Strong surf with some challenging paddles
- Potential for fun barrels on the right day
- Best for surfers comfortable handling variable beach-break conditions
